> OK. Then I must have missed the bits where the tables are changed.
> Hm...
In output.c:
/* GLR parsers need space for conflict lists, so we can't
default conflicted entries. For non-conflicted entries
or as long as we are not building a GLR parser,
actions that match the default are replaced with zero,
which means "use the default". */
if (max > 0)
{
int j;
for (j = 0; j < ntokens; j++)
if (actrow[j] == -default_rule
&& ! (glr_parser && conflrow[j]))
actrow[j] = 0;
}
}
> Would you say we ought to keep the same `output', with $default, as a
> means to compress output, not the parser?
Oh, I don't really think so. It would require extra work to do so
(since the entry doesn't look defaulted in GLR mode at the point the
report is made), and I really don't expect there to be a huge number
of conflicting entries in general anyway.
